Understanding Stablecoins and Their Role

Stablecoins are cryptocurrencies designed to maintain a stable value relative to a specific asset, typically the US dollar. USDT and USDC are the most prominent examples, aiming for a 1:1 peg with the USD. They achieve this through various mechanisms, including holding fiat currency reserves or using algorithmic stabilization.

Their primary advantage in trading is providing a safe haven during market downturns. Instead of converting back to fiat (which can be slow and incur fees), traders can hold their funds in stablecoins, ready to redeploy when opportunities arise. This is crucial for a strategy like Funding Rate Harvesting, which requires consistent capital allocation.

Perpetual Futures Contracts and Funding Rates

Before diving into the strategy, it's essential to understand perpetual futures contracts. Unlike traditional futures contracts with an expiration date, perpetual futures have no settlement date. To maintain alignment with the spot price of the underlying asset, exchanges utilize a mechanism called the "Funding Rate."

The Funding Rate is a periodic payment exchanged between traders holding long positions and those holding short positions.
